Casement windows installation is a crucial aspect of enhancing both the aesthetic appeal and functional efficiency of a home. These windows, hinged at the side, open outward to the left or right, providing excellent ventilation and unobstructed views. Proper installation ensures that the windows operate smoothly and seal tightly, which is vital for maintaining energy efficiency and preventing air and water infiltration. A professional installation guarantees that the windows are aligned correctly, which not only enhances their performance but also prolongs their lifespan. This process involves precise measurements and expert handling to ensure that the windows fit perfectly within their frames, contributing to the overall comfort and security of the home. Benefits of Casement Windows Installation
-
Enhanced Ventilation
Casement windows are designed to open fully, allowing maximum airflow into the home. This design is particularly beneficial for rooms that require good ventilation, such as kitchens and bathrooms. The ability to direct breezes into the home can create a more comfortable indoor environment. -
Improved Security
The locking mechanism on casement windows is embedded within the frame, making it more difficult for potential intruders to tamper with. This feature provides homeowners with added peace of mind, knowing that their windows offer a higher level of security compared to other window types. -
Unobstructed Views
With no central bar or muntins, casement windows offer clear, unobstructed views of the outdoors. This feature not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of a home but also allows more natural light to enter, creating a brighter and more inviting living space.
